We are looking for a Health and Safety Manager to join our well known Highways Client on a Full Time, Permanent basis.
To be considered for this role you must:
- Come from either a Highways, Rail, Construction or New Build background
- Hold a degree or NEBOSH Diploma in Health and Safety
- Membership of recognised professional body e.g. IOSH
- Have strong communication skills
- Have knowledge of the design, construct, operate and maintain asset lifecycle
- Have sound knowledge of CM2015
- Have experience with big Civil Engineering projects
- Evidence of strong Stakeholder Management skills
The successful candidate will be acting as client representative with responsibility for developing robust, collaborative relationships with designers, contactors and other stakeholders to ensure Health and Safety is at the forefront of all design and construction projects. You will be using your knowledge and experience of health and safety management in large construction projects to ensure successful delivery of projects.
